How does adrenaline affect your heart and blood pressure?

How does adrenaline affect your heart and blood pressure?

Epinephrine. Epinephrine, more commonly known as adrenaline, is a hormone secreted by the medulla of the adrenal glands. Strong emotions such as fear or anger cause epinephrine to be released into the bloodstream, which causes an increase in heart rate, muscle strength, blood pressure, and sugar metabolism.

Can high adrenaline cause heart palpitations?

Isolated palpitations typically occur when a small rush of adrenaline courses through your body, causing your heart to beat more forcefully than usual. These surges can be generated by a strong emotion such as excitement, fear, or anger. They also can come on after consuming a stimulant such as caffeine.

How does the adrenaline induce such changes of heart rate and pressure?

Hence, epinephrine causes constriction in many networks of minute blood vessels but dilates the blood vessels in the skeletal muscles and the liver. In the heart, it increases the rate and force of contraction, thus increasing the output of blood and raising blood pressure.

Can adrenaline affect memory?

The limbic system includes the hypothalamus, the hippocampus, the amygdala, and other important brain structures that govern emotional responses, behavior, and long-term memory. The release of adrenaline increases levels of activity in these areas of the brain and has been associated with improved memory.

How can adrenaline affect the heart?

Adrenaline is a hormone produced by the adrenal glands, which affects all types of metabolism. Release of this hormone in the blood in large quantities causes constriction of blood vessels, increases blood pressure, enhances and speeds up heart rate, which in some cases can threaten human health.

How does adrenaline and acetylcholine affect heart rate?

Adrenaline speeds it up and Acetylcholine slows it down . They both have their effect by modifying the conductance for ions such as Sodium, Potassium and Calcium across the membrane of the cells of the SA node. Adrenaline: increase the influx of Sodium and Calcium across the membrane of the cells of the SA node leading to faster heart rate.

What causes too much adrenaline?

Medical conditions that cause an overproduction of adrenaline are rare, but can happen. If an individual has tumors on the adrenal glands, for example, he/she may produce too much adrenaline; leading to anxiety, weight loss, palpitations, rapid heartbeat, and high blood pressure.

What causes high adrenaline levels?

Medical conditions can also increase sympathetic nervous system activity and elevate your adrenaline level. Examples include a heart attack, heart failure and any condition leading to shock. Rare tumors can also cause high adrenaline levels.
